The kneading action felt just like having a personal masseur at home. Speaking of kneading, shiatsu devices typically emulate the finger pressure and rhythmic motions that define Shiatsu massage. This is achieved with precision-engineered nodes that rotate and apply pressure at specific points.

From a technological perspective, these devices leverage an intricate combination of heat, speed, and pressure modulation to deliver customizable massage experiences. The heating function is particularly effective, as it enhances blood circulation and reduces lactic acid build-up. Speaking of which, studies reveal that heat can increase blood flow by up to 40%.
